: Utilizing Influencer Marketing for Wide Audience Reach

Digital Marketing


Are you looking for a powerful and effective way to expand your brand's reach and connect with new audiences? Look no further than influencer marketing. This rapidly growing form of marketing utilizes the influence and credibility of popular individuals on social media to promote products and services. By partnering with relevant influencers, you can effectively target and engage with a wider audience, potentially leading to increased brand recognition, sales, and loyal customers.

So, how exactly can you use influencer marketing to reach new audiences? Let's dive into the key steps and strategies you should implement.

1. Identify Your Target Audience

The first step in any marketing campaign is to identify your target audience. This is crucial for influencer marketing as well. Take a close look at your existing customer base and their demographics, interests, and behaviors. This will help you determine the type of influencer who would resonate with your target audience.

For example, if you're a fashion brand targeting young adults, partnering with a popular fashion influencer on Instagram would be more effective than collaborating with a food blogger.

2. Research and Connect with Relevant Influencers

Finding the right influencer for your brand can be a daunting task, but it's essential to choose someone who aligns with your brand's values and aesthetic. Start by researching influencers in your niche and review their content, engagement rates, and audience demographics. You can also use influencer marketing platforms like AspireIQ or Upfluence to help you find and connect with relevant influencers.

When reaching out to influencers, be sure to personalize your pitch and explain why you think they would be a good fit for your brand. Building a genuine relationship with influencers is crucial for the success of your campaign.

3. Collaborate on Engaging Content

Influencers are experts in creating content that resonates with their followers. That's why it's essential to collaborate with influencers on creating engaging content that showcases your brand. Whether it's through sponsored posts, product reviews, or giveaways, the key is to highlight your brand in a way that feels organic and authentic to the influencer's audience.

4. Leverage the Power of Social Media

Influencer marketing is most effective when it's shared on social media. Be sure to promote your campaign on your own social media platforms to reach your existing followers and potentially new ones. Encourage influencers to share the content on their social media pages as well. This will not only help increase brand awareness but also drive more traffic to your website and potentially increase conversions.

5. Measure and Analyze Results

It's essential to track and analyze the results of your influencer marketing campaign. This will help you determine its success and make any necessary tweaks for future campaigns. Some key metrics to monitor include engagement rates, website traffic, and conversion rates.

"Unlock Your Marketing Potential: The Power of LinkedIn Sponsored Content"

Digital Marketing


Are you looking for innovative ways to reach your target audience and make a lasting impact? Look no further than LinkedIn Sponsored Content. With over 690 million users, LinkedIn offers a highly engaged and professional audience for businesses to connect with.

So, what exactly is LinkedIn Sponsored Content and how can you use it to your advantage? Simply put, Sponsored Content is a form of native advertising on LinkedIn that allows businesses to promote their content (such as blog posts, videos, and webinars) directly to their target audience's LinkedIn feeds.

However, with so many businesses vying for attention on the platform, it's important to have a solid strategy in place for your LinkedIn Sponsored Content campaigns. Here are our top strategies for making the most out of this powerful advertising tool.

1. Identify Your Objectives
Before creating any sponsored content, it's crucial to identify your marketing objectives. Are you looking to build brand awareness, generate leads, or increase website traffic? Once you have a clear goal in mind, you can tailor your content and targeting to achieve that objective.

2. Know Your Audience
One of the biggest advantages of LinkedIn Sponsored Content is the ability to target your desired audience based on factors such as job title, industry, and company size. Take advantage of these targeting options by identifying your ideal customer profile and creating content that will resonate with them.

3. Create Engaging Content
In order to capture your audience's attention and encourage them to take action, your sponsored content must be visually appealing and engaging. Use eye-catching visuals, attention-grabbing headlines, and compelling messaging to stand out in the crowded LinkedIn feed.

4. Test and Refine
As with any marketing strategy, it's important to continually test and refine your LinkedIn Sponsored Content campaigns. Experiment with different visuals, headlines, and targeting options to see what resonates best with your audience. Use A/B testing to track the performance of different variations and make adjustments accordingly.

5. Utilize Lead Generation Forms
If your objective is to generate leads, LinkedIn's Lead Gen Forms are a powerful tool to capture valuable information from potential customers. These pre-filled forms make it easy for users to submit their information without leaving the LinkedIn platform, increasing the chances of conversion.

6. Leverage LinkedIn's Ad Manager
LinkedIn's Ad Manager provides valuable insights and data on your sponsored content campaigns, allowing you to track metrics such as clicks, impressions, and conversions. Use this information to optimize your campaigns and make data-driven decisions for future campaigns.

7. Don't Forget about Mobile Users
With more and more people accessing LinkedIn through their mobile devices, it's important to ensure that your sponsored content is optimized for mobile viewing. Make sure your visuals and messaging are optimized for smaller screens and that your landing pages are mobile-friendly for a seamless user experience.

8. Monitor and Engage with Comments
One of the benefits of sponsored content on LinkedIn is the opportunity for users to engage with your content and leave comments. Make sure to monitor and respond to these comments, as it can help increase engagement and build a connection with your target audience.

9. Consider a Combination of Sponsored and Organic Content
LinkedIn's algorithm favors content that receives engagement, meaning that if your sponsored content is also receiving engagement in the form of likes, shares, and comments, it is more likely to be shown to a wider audience organically. Consider a combination of sponsored and organic content to maximize your reach and engagement.

10. Measure and Evaluate Results
As with any marketing effort, make sure to measure and evaluate the results of your LinkedIn Sponsored Content campaigns. Which metrics are most important to your objectives? Use this data to inform future campaigns and continue to refine and improve your strategy.
